Changing, Yet Remaining

949

I’ve been thinking about change.  Sand dunes blow, shift, rearrange with time, wind, and water.  Yet the essence of the sand dune remains.  It’s still sand; it is still present in some form although maybe different.  Storms blow through all our lives, rearranging things, shifting priorities, helping us to see what’s really important.  Family, friends, Jesus, love, sacrifice for others, giving, smiling, caring….those are the things that remain.  Things may look different, but they are really the same.  “And now these three remain: faith, hope and love.  But the greatest of these if love.” ~1Corinthians 13:13  Hold on to what remains, and know that no matter what changes come into your life, God’s love for you remains steady and unchanging, always.  Slainte, Lisa
